#423555 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#423555 is composed of 25.9% red, 20.8% green and 33.3%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 22.4% cyan, 37.6% magenta, 0% yellow and 66.7% black. It has a hue angle of 264.4 degrees, a saturation of 23.2% and a lightness of 27.1%. #423555 color hex could be obtained by blending #846aaa with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#333366.

#423555 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#423555 has RGB values of R:66, G:53, B:85 and CMYK values of C:0.22, M:0.38, Y:0, K:0.67. Its decimal value is 4339029.

Shades and Tints of #423555
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#000000 is the darkest color, while #f5f3f8 is the lightest one.

Tones of #423555
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#454545 is the less saturated color, while #390585 is the most saturated one.
